Output cd8c31268af3e178909e27d77207b2f4b914e750b2a6452e0471bd1b9366d110:0

value
18680566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f2e43d4872f534280e891d86f66136392091be OP_EQUAL
address
3MCGpoearU2Ypcp6Z9gvqkguTPPpdpTNqY
transaction
cd8c31268af3e178909e27d77207b2f4b914e750b2a6452e0471bd1b9366d110